Profile
Jude Daniel is a chartered tax practitioner, a management consultant and an active member of the Bar Association. He headed the Pro Bono and Litigation Department of Miyetti Law firm between 2017 and 2019, after a robust legal practice as a counsel in the law firm of Adegboyega Awomolo (SAN) & Associates for a period spanning about 5 (five) years.
He has appeared on several intellectual and professional panels, written and delivered several papers including: The Admissibility of Electronic Evidence (2003), The Petroleum Industry Bill (P.I.B.): Impact on Stakeholders and the Oil and Gas Sector (2015) and Tax Administration in Nigeria: the Need for Better Approaches (2017). He was also a co-contributor to ICLG on Nigeria: Corporate Recovery and Insolvency 2019.
Briefly highlighted below are some of his practice milestones:
Election Petition and Political Matters
- Worked with a consortium of law firms that represented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) in all States and National pre- and post-election litigation between 2011 and 2016.
- Was an active member of the Petitioner’s Legal Team in the 2019 Presidential Election Tribunal and the Appeals to the Supreme Court, playing pivotal role in the areas of research, evidence gathering, monitoring and keeping up with fundamental regulations, guidelines and timelines.
- Secured judgment that recognized the leadership of Chief (Mrs) Chika Ibeneme as the National Chairperson of the Mass Action Joint Alliance (MAJA) Party and finally laid to rest the leadership crisis of the Party in 2019.
Taxation and Enforcement of Judgment
- Led a Team that represented the Adamawa State Board of Internal Revenue to recover Income Tax and Development Levies of about N1.7 Billion Naira between 2017 and early 2019.
- Successfully levied execution on the account of a judgment debtor domiciled with the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N) under the Treasury Single Account (TSA) Policy of the Federal Government.
Debt Recovery
- Led a Team that represented Asset Management Corporation (AMCON) in asset tracing and debt recovery of about N2 Billion Naira from a multinational oil and gas company in 2018.
Corporate Law
- Has registered several intellectual properties in Nigeria for local and international owners.
- Has incorporated several multinational companies in Nigeria for local and foreign clients.
